Product Description
When Guerrilla Marketing was first published in 1983, Jay Levinson revolutionized marketing strategies for the small-business owner with his take-no-prisoners approach to finding clients. Based on hundreds of solid ideas that really work, Levinson’s philosophy has given birth to a new way of learning about market share and how to gain it. In this completely updated and expanded fourth edition, Levinson offers a new arsenal of weaponry for small-business success including
* strategies for marketing on the Internet (explaining when and precisely how to use it)
* tips for using new technology, such as podcasting and automated marketing
* programs for targeting prospects and cultivating repeat and referral business
* management lessons in the age of telecommuting and freelance employees
Guerrilla Marketing is the entrepreneur’s marketing bible -- and the book every small-business owner should have on his or her shelf.

I hope our competitors don't read this! May 26, 2008 Stephen A. Rhodes (Temecula, CA) 3 out of 3 found this review helpful
An easy and friendly read, packed full of information... Many ideas you may already know, but have never taken full advantage of. At least a dozen strategies you can start using right now, and a few more that you will really need to plan carefully to use effectively. Levinson explains the importance of focussed and consistent advertising, referrals, testimonials and so much more. You'll learn about how and why you need to get it right BEFORE you advertise, then a multitude of simple ways to get your message out there. I've been in the design and advertising business for 30 years. I have always had some cool ideas for the graphic design... now I'm getting the MESSAGE right, too! This book has given me new insight into how we can get the best return on a small budget. I'm using these ideas at my full-time job for a commercial printer, as well as with a new business my wife and I started in October, 2007. So far, even in this dismal economy, we're seeing 10 to 20% growth each month. Thank you Jay. Almost every page of this book is covered in yellow highlighter!
